I have previously used Motus Peak for motion analysis in animal models
conducted during my dissertation research. However, I am now using
Vicon with my post-doctoral studies in human gait analysis. In
Peak, I was able to construct stick figures of limbs that showed a 2-D
representation of how the limb moved through space over time (this
created an overlay). I am trying to figure out if there is an easy way
to do this same thing in Vicon. Any suggestions or feedback is greatly
appreciated!
